## Alert: StatRelay Sidecar Flush Lag

This alert fires when the StatRelay metrics-aggregation sidecar falls more than 120 seconds behind on flushing buffered samples to the Coalmine backend. Plugin-emitted counters are buffered in-process, so sustained lag usually means a plugin is emitting unbounded label cardinality or blocking the flush thread. Check your plugin's metric registration against the published cardinality limits before escalating. If the lag persists after your plugin is ruled out, contact the telemetry team.

escalation mailbox, bagug-fahof: novdor.wendor.jormir@norvalabs.example

## v7.9.0 — Key Rotation Notice

Support team: we rotated the signing key for the Marrowtide alerting pipeline after last week's read-replica lag incident. The replica lag alarm on the Cobalt Harbor cluster now fires at 30 seconds instead of 120, so expect more pages until we tune thresholds. Alerts signed with the old key will fail verification after Friday — tell customers to update their webhook validators. Docs in the runbook wiki have been refreshed. The new signing key is as follows.

signing key of bagap-yawep = bky13_TbfT6ZMUoGJo2

Onboarding note for the Ledgerpane admin table: bulk edits are applied through the batcher service, not directly against the database. Select rows, choose an action, and the batcher stages changes in a pending set you can review before commit. Edits over 500 rows require a second approver — this is enforced server-side, so don't try to chunk around it. To run the batcher locally you need the staging write credential, which goes in your .env as the next line.

secret setting of bahip-kagag: RELAY_SECRET3=c83

## Runbook: Formula Sandbox (Quillbox)

User formulas execute inside the Tessit sandbox: no network, 256MB cap, 2s timeout. If the sandbox pool drains, restart `tessit-workerd` and replay the stuck queue. Do not raise limits without sign-off from the eval-safety rota. Escalations route through the Brindle pager. To replay jobs you must authenticate against the internal Tessit admin API; the current key for staging is below.

gateway credential: kto23_dolYgAScEh2TaPOlStqOl98